Pink Mullein 'Rosetta'
Scientific name: Verbascum phoeniceum 'Rosetta'
'Rosetta' forms compact rosettes of foliage and sends up flower spikes with deep rose-pink blooms in late spring to early summer. Cutting back spent flower stalks after the first flush may encourage additional bloom. The flower stems can also be used for cutting.
Growing Conditions
- Light: Full sun to part shade
- Hardiness Zones: 4–8
- Height: About 2.5 feet
- Spread: About 1 foot
- Bloom: Late spring to early summer
